  14. bolo specialist

    bolo specialist Boxing Addict Full Member

    3,847
    7,653
    Jun 10, 2024
    I believe that was actually Bramble-Rosario? The idea was that Bramble & Camacho had separate fights on the same card, & each fighter's expected win would set up a unification w/ each other. When Rosario unexpectedly won, Larry Merchant said, "the preamble to Bramble has become the scenario for Rosario."
